Dies ist eines von 4644 IT-Projekten, die wir erfolgreich mit unseren Kunden abgeschlossen haben.

Wobei dürfen wir Sie unterstützen?

Weißes Quadrat mit umrandeten Seiten rechts oben

Aufbau einer Monitoring Plattform

Projektdauer: 6 Monate

Kurzbeschreibung

Zur Ablösung von heterogenen Legacy-Monitoringsystemen soll eine zentrale State-of-the-Art Monitoring Plattform aufgebaut werden. Damit wird einerseits die Überwachung der gesamten IT-Infrastruktur des Kunden gewährleistet und andererseits die Nutzung von Monitoring-Services für sämtliche interne Produkte ermöglicht. Eine zentrale Anforderung an die Plattform stellt die Hochverfügbarkeit dar, sodass alle Komponenten aus dem Monitoring Stack (Grafana, InfluxDB, Telegraf, Graylog und Icinga) und die zugehörigen Backend Tools und DBs redundant vom internen Monitoring-Team auf einem dedizierten VMware-Cluster provisioniert wurden. Die Umsetzung des Projektes war an die agilen Methodiken und insbesondere an Scrum angelehnt und von der PTA sowohl organisatorisch geleitet als auch fachlich und technisch beraten und unterstützt.

Ergänzung

Die hohe Verfügbarkeit wird wie folgt konzipiert und implementiert. Vor Grafana und Graylog wird ein HAProxy-Loadbalancer mit einem Keepalived Daemon geschaltet. Die zentrale Metriken-Datenbank InfluxDB wird als ein Cluster in der Enterprise Version ausgesetzt. Die Metadaten Datenbank für die Grafana-Dashboards wird als ein MariaDB Galera Cluster aufgesetzt. Weiterhin wird MariaDB ebenfalls als eine Metadaten DB für die Alarmierungsplattform Icinga verwendet. Die Alarmierung für abgeschottete Systeme in fremden Netzwerksegmenten wird durch einen Icinga-Satelliten implementiert. Für die Metrikensammlung werden Telegraf-Agents auf dem jeweiligen Server (VM) mithilfe von Puppet provisioniert. Ferner erfolgt die Verteilung der Agent-Konfigurationen ebenfalls automatisiert mithilfe von Puppet.

Fachbeschreibung

Das Monitoring teilt sich in zwei wesentliche Sparten auf: das fachliche und technische Systemmonitoring von Servern, Services, Soft- und Middleware und das Log- und Analysis Monitoring. Das Systemmonitoring soll neben der Ablösung der Legacy Alarmierungssystemen eine Mandanten-fähige Überwachung von internen Produkten in Form von Monitoring-Services ermöglichen. Die internen Kunden können eigenständig für Ihr Produkt auf der Plattform ein Dashboard zusammenstellen und die zugehörigen Metriken implementieren. Das Log Monitoring stellt eine neue zentrale Plattform für die Loganalyse dar, die sowohl den Administratoren und Entwicklern eine effiziente Analyse ermöglicht als auch die fachliche Überwachung gewährleistet.

Überblick

Projektzeitraum07.06.2017 - 12.12.2017

Haben wir Ihr Interesse geweckt?